What is Commercial Boarding Up?
Commercial boarding up describes the procedure of briefly protecting windows and doors of commercial residential or commercial properties by covering them with panels or boards. This practice is typically used during emergencies such as natural catastrophes, vandalism, or restorations, or when a business leaves an establishment empty for a prolonged duration. The supreme goal is to avoid unapproved gain access to, hinder theft, and secure property versus damage.
Why is Commercial Boarding Up Necessary?
The requirement for commercial boarding up typically develops for several factors:

Natural Disasters: Hurricanes, tornadoes, and severe storms can trigger considerable damage to buildings through high winds and flying debris. Boarding up can decrease possible damage to windows and doors.

Vandalism and Theft: Unsecured properties are susceptible to break-ins and Emergency Vandalism Repair. Boarding up can discourage criminal activity and safeguard valuable inventory and equipment.

Building and construction and Renovations: During refurbishment, it might be essential to limit access to specific areas, guaranteeing safety and security.

Long-Term Vacancies: Unoccupied structures can become targets for squatting or breaking and going into. Boarding up deals protection till the property can be protected or repurposed.

Screw and Anchor: Secure the boards to the window or door frames utilizing screws that penetrate deeply into the wall for stability.

Brackets: Use brackets to strengthen the boards, particularly for larger openings.

Secure with Bolts: In high-risk locations, bolts can be utilized for added security, guaranteeing that boards can not be quickly removed.

Frame Construction: For prolonged direct exposure, constructing a frame to hold the boards rather of attaching straight to the structure can be useful.

Finest Practices for Boarding Up
To guarantee the effectiveness of commercial boarding up, particular best practices should be followed:

Assess vulnerabilities: Identify all points of entry and assess the weak points that might be made use of during a crisis.

Make use of the right products: Choose the appropriate boarding products based upon the level of hazard and period of boarding up.

Professional installation: For larger or heavily affected properties, engaging Professional Board Up Service services can ensure exceptional security and compliance with local regulations.

Preserve secure access points: Even while boarding up, make sure that you have secure gain access to points for 24-Hour Emergency Board Up services, if essential.

Regular evaluations: Periodically check the boarding to ensure it remains secure and undamaged, especially after storms or high winds.
Frequently Asked Questions About Commercial Boarding UpWhat is the perfect thickness for plywood boarding?
A thickness of at least 1/2 inch is advised for plywood boarding up to guarantee it can hold up against high winds and effect.
How can I get rid of boards after installation?
Typically, unscrewing the boards or getting rid of bolts need to permit simple elimination. Nevertheless, it is important to have the correct tools on hand.
Can I board up my business myself?
Yes, many companies choose to board up themselves; however, it is typically advised to hire professionals for larger properties or in high-risk situations.
For how long can boards keep up?
The time boards can stay in location depends upon various aspects, consisting of local regulations, the security required, and physical conditions affecting the property.
How do I protect my business from possible vandalism when it is closed?
In addition to boarding up, consider installing security cameras, lighting, and alarm to improve the overall security of your property when closed.
